Plain-English version

What we collect

To provide the service we need basic personal and device information: your name, email, billing details, IP, device and browser info, and where your venue is located. You confirm you're 18 or older when you create an account.

What we use it for

To run Audiimax, bill your subscription, support you when something's wrong, improve the platform, and occasionally send you offers or newsletters you can unsubscribe from at any time.

Where your data lives

Audiimax is operated by AudiiMax Ltd in England. Data may be processed in the UK or EEA, and — for users in non-EEA markets — in our regional processing locations. We only transfer data to processors who meet applicable data protection law.

Cookies

We use cookies for sign-in and product analytics. You can refuse cookies from your browser, but doing so may limit parts of the service.

Your rights

You can request access to, rectification or erasure of your personal data, or restrict or object to its processing. Email support@audiimax.com to exercise any of these.

Changes to this policy

We may revise this policy from time to time. Material changes will be communicated via email or in-app notice.


Full legal text

1. What is this policy?

This Privacy Policy sets out the terms on which we collect, process and handle personal data which you provide to us while using or otherwise acceding the app known as "AUDIIMAX" and/or the site at www.audiimax.com (together the "Site") and the services provided from the Site ("Service"). The Site, together with all content on each, is owned or controlled by AUDIIMAX Ltd, a company registered in England, with offices at 110a Chelmsford Road, Shenfield, Brentwood CM15 8RN, UK ("we" or "our" or "Company").

2. What data will Audiimax collect from me?

To provide the Service, it is necessary for us to collect and process certain personal information ("Data"), including some or all of the following: name, address, date of birth, gender, email addresses and mobile phone numbers, IP addresses, device and web-browser details, operating system details, activities on the Site, personal preferences, billing and financial information such as credit/debit card numbers, and details of the locations from which you use the Service. The Company does not offer the Service to anyone under the age of 18.

3. How will Audiimax use my data?

The Data will be stored together with any additional information you provide to us, and will be used to provide you with (and to improve) the Service. This includes marketing and research-related activities, administrative services, responding to enquiries, and improving the Site. From time to time we may transfer Data obtained from Users located in the UK and/or the EU to locations outside the UK and/or the EEA, some of which may have different data protection laws. In all such cases we transmit such information only to entities that comply with this policy and applicable law.

4. Links on the Site

The Site may display links to certain third party websites. We encourage you to read the individual privacy policies of those third party websites before providing any of your personal information to them.

5. Cookies

We may use 'cookies' while you access the Site to avoid the need to re-enter details on different occasions. Cookies are also used to collect general usage and volume statistical information. Most web browsers are automatically set up to accept cookies, but you can set your browser to refuse cookies. Please note that we do not recommend turning cookies off when using the Service, as this may prevent you from using certain aspects of the Services and/or the Site.

6. Can I opt out?

You have the right to request access to and rectification or erasure of Data, or to object to or request the restriction of processing of your Data. Subject to applicable law, you may withdraw your consent (i.e. "opt out") by contacting us at support@audiimax.com. If you are not interested in receiving email notices or advertisements from us, you should unsubscribe via your "Account Settings" on the Site, or by emailing support@audiimax.com with "Unsubscribe" in the subject line.

7. Will Audiimax ever change this policy?

We may change this Privacy Policy from time to time and such changes shall be effective from the date and time the revised Privacy Policy is posted on the Site. We encourage you to review our Privacy Policy on a regular basis so that you will be aware of any changes to it.
